Output d3b276f391ca8cfeb959d4f7c306eb6299d0ec30c600889cbbdc872d9cd5b677:154

value
51188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ebae110929a2dc03f1caa70ad572465eaeef6ed9 OP_EQUAL
address
3PBBEymTpN36ZKTaKZ1YeVnPAxNuBWKwkG
transaction
d3b276f391ca8cfeb959d4f7c306eb6299d0ec30c600889cbbdc872d9cd5b677
spent
true